Product Overview
Indium Tin Oxide (ITO) Spherical Granules are transparent conductive materials composed of 90% indium oxide (In₂O₃) and 10% tin oxide (SnO₂). These granules offer an excellent combination of electrical conductivity and optical transparency, making them indispensable in modern electronics. ITO spherical granules are commonly used in thin-film deposition technologies, providing high transparency and conductivity.

Applications
- Display Technology: Widely used in LCDs, plasma displays, touch screens, and electronic paper
- Optoelectronics: Utilized in organic light-emitting diodes (OLEDs), solar cells, and transparent electrodes
- Antistatic & EMI Shielding: Applied extensively in antistatic coatings and electromagnetic interference shielding
- Optical Coatings: Used in infrared-reflective coatings, architectural films, automotive glass, etc.
- Sensors & Lasers: Applied in gas sensors, antireflection coatings, and VCSEL laser Bragg reflectors
- High-Temperature Applications: ITO thin-film strain gauges can be used in harsh environments above 1400°C, such as in gas turbines, jet engines, and rocket engines
